Orophea hirsuta King

毛澄广花

Description from Flora of China

Shrubs to 4 m tall. Branchlets, petioles, leaf blades abaxially, and peduncles persistently ferruginous hispid. Petiole 1-2 mm; leaf blade elliptic to oblong, 3.5-12 × 1.5-5 cm, papery, secondary veins 7-11 on each side of midvein, base obliquely shallowly cordate, apex acuminate to acute. Inflorescences superaxillary, cymose, 1-3-flowered; peduncle 1-1.5 cm. Pedicel ca. 4.5 mm, with 1 or 2 bracteoles at base. Sepals broadly ovate, puberulent. Petals reddish; outer petals broadly ovate, 3-4 mm, outside puberulent; inner petals ca. 8 mm, inside sparsely puberulent, basally long clawed, apically lozenge-shaped. Stamens 6. Carpels 3-6, glabrous; ovules 2 or 3 per carpel. Monocarp stipes 1-2 mm; monocarps globose, 0.8-1.3 cm in diam., sparsely villous. Fl. Apr-Jul, fr. Jul-Dec.

Forested slopes; 300-600 m. Hainan, S Yunnan [Cambodia, India, Laos, Malaysia, Vietnam].
